Output 1596412f4fe1d2ac43000c02ae59ce528cfe84a4dbfad357189de9474870a5ea:0

value
593145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74129725457b15b1218b0f096d4e6877036fae8a OP_EQUAL
address
MJUttNEub95pPUiJigJt7DKnjPeEtgyiBZ
transaction
1596412f4fe1d2ac43000c02ae59ce528cfe84a4dbfad357189de9474870a5ea
spent
true